1. Server Location
The physical location of servers is a pivotal factor in determining the efficacy of electronic mail hosting services within New Zealand. This aspect directly impacts latency, data sovereignty, and compliance with local regulations, ultimately influencing the performance and reliability of digital communication for organizations.
-
Latency and Speed
Servers situated closer to the user base generally provide lower latency and faster data transmission speeds. For businesses primarily operating within New Zealand, servers physically located within the country can significantly reduce the time required to send and receive emails, leading to improved responsiveness and overall user experience. Conversely, distant servers may introduce delays, negatively affecting productivity.
-
Data Sovereignty and Compliance
Data sovereignty refers to the principle that data is subject to the laws and regulations of the country in which it is located. Hosting data on servers within New Zealand ensures compliance with local privacy laws, such as the Privacy Act 2020. This is particularly crucial for organizations handling sensitive personal information, as it mandates specific data protection requirements. Storing data outside New Zealand may subject it to foreign laws, potentially creating legal and compliance complexities.
-
Disaster Recovery and Redundancy
Geographic diversity in server locations can enhance disaster recovery capabilities. Hosting data across multiple servers in different locations, including those within New Zealand, provides redundancy in the event of a natural disaster or other unforeseen circumstances. This ensures business continuity and minimizes downtime, as services can be seamlessly switched to unaffected servers.
-
Network Infrastructure and Connectivity
The quality of the network infrastructure and connectivity at the server location directly impacts service reliability. Servers located in areas with robust network infrastructure, such as major metropolitan centers within New Zealand, benefit from stable connections and high bandwidth. This translates to improved uptime and reduced risk of service interruptions, crucial for maintaining consistent communication.

3. Security Protocols
The implementation of robust security protocols forms a cornerstone of optimal electronic mail services within New Zealand. Inadequate security measures can lead to data breaches, financial losses, and reputational damage, underscoring the critical importance of selecting hosting providers that prioritize data protection. The correlation between security protocols and electronic mail hosting is a direct causal relationship: stronger protocols directly result in more secure and reliable communication channels. For example, a financial institution employing end-to-end encryption and multi-factor authentication significantly reduces the risk of unauthorized access to sensitive client information. The absence of these protocols, conversely, creates vulnerabilities that malicious actors can exploit.
Effective security protocols encompass various technologies and practices. These include Transport Layer Security (TLS) encryption, which safeguards data in transit; Secure/Multipurpose Internet Mail Extensions (S/MIME) for digitally signing and encrypting messages; and robust spam and phishing filters to prevent malicious content from reaching users’ inboxes. Multi-factor authentication (MFA) adds an additional layer of security by requiring users to provide multiple forms of identification, mitigating the risk of password compromise. Regularly updated intrusion detection and prevention systems further enhance security by identifying and blocking suspicious network activity. Consider a law firm that handles confidential client data: implementing these security measures ensures compliance with ethical obligations and protects sensitive information from unauthorized disclosure. The practical significance of these protocols lies in their ability to minimize the risk of data breaches, maintain user trust, and ensure business continuity.

4. Uptime Guarantee
Uptime guarantee is a fundamental aspect of optimal electronic mail services within New Zealand. It represents a commitment by the hosting provider to maintain a specified level of operational availability, typically expressed as a percentage. The relationship between the uptime guarantee and the selection of electronic mail services is direct: a higher guarantee theoretically translates to fewer service interruptions and greater reliability for businesses operating within the region.
-
Impact on Business Continuity
A high uptime guarantee directly supports business continuity by minimizing disruptions to electronic mail communication. For example, a business with a 99.9% uptime guarantee can expect only approximately 8.76 hours of downtime per year. This is particularly critical for organizations that rely heavily on email for day-to-day operations, such as customer service, sales, and internal communication. Conversely, a lower uptime guarantee increases the risk of service interruptions, potentially leading to lost productivity, missed opportunities, and customer dissatisfaction.
-
Service Level Agreements (SLAs)
Uptime guarantees are typically formalized within Service Level Agreements (SLAs). These agreements outline the specific terms and conditions of the guarantee, including the remedies available to the customer in the event of a breach. For example, an SLA may specify that the customer is entitled to a partial refund or service credit if the uptime falls below the guaranteed level. Understanding the terms of the SLA is essential for assessing the value of the uptime guarantee and ensuring that the hosting provider is held accountable for maintaining service availability.
-
Technical Infrastructure and Redundancy
The ability to deliver on an uptime guarantee is directly linked to the quality and redundancy of the hosting provider’s technical infrastructure. This includes redundant servers, network connections, and power supplies, as well as robust disaster recovery plans. Hosting providers with geographically diverse data centers are better positioned to maintain uptime in the event of a localized outage. Therefore, evaluating the provider’s technical infrastructure is crucial for assessing the credibility of the uptime guarantee.
-
Monitoring and Response Times
Effective monitoring and rapid response times are essential for maintaining high uptime. Hosting providers should have systems in place to continuously monitor the performance of their servers and network, and they should be able to quickly identify and resolve any issues that may threaten uptime. The speed and effectiveness of the provider’s response to outages directly impact the actual uptime experienced by the customer. Consequently, assessing the provider’s monitoring capabilities and response protocols is a key aspect of evaluating the uptime guarantee.

7. Pricing Structure
The pricing structure of electronic mail hosting services in New Zealand significantly influences the perceived value and overall suitability of a provider. The connection between pricing and the designation of “best email hosting nz” is multifaceted, encompassing considerations of cost-effectiveness, transparency, and scalability. A provider’s pricing model can directly affect an organization’s operational budget and long-term financial planning. For instance, a business operating on a tight budget may prioritize a provider offering a lower initial cost, even if it entails limitations in storage or features. Conversely, a larger enterprise might be willing to invest in a more expensive solution that offers superior security, reliability, and support. Therefore, the ‘best’ option is inextricably linked to the organization’s financial resources and priorities.
Various pricing models exist within the electronic mail hosting market, including per-user fees, tiered pricing based on storage or features, and flat-rate plans. Each model presents its own advantages and disadvantages, depending on the size and nature of the organization. Per-user fees can be advantageous for smaller businesses with a limited number of employees, as they only pay for the active accounts. Tiered pricing allows organizations to scale their service as their needs evolve, but it can become expensive as they move to higher tiers. Flat-rate plans provide predictability in budgeting but may not be cost-effective for smaller organizations. Some providers also offer add-on services, such as enhanced security or dedicated support, which can further complicate the pricing structure. The presence of hidden fees or unexpected charges can undermine the perceived value of a provider, regardless of the initial cost.

Consider, for instance, a start-up company experiencing rapid growth. Initially, a basic electronic mail plan may suffice; however, as the employee headcount increases and data storage needs expand, the ability to seamlessly upgrade storage capacity, user accounts, and other resources becomes paramount. Providers offering granular scalability options, allowing businesses to incrementally adjust their service levels, are better positioned to meet the dynamic needs of growing organizations.
The practical significance of scalability extends beyond simply adding more storage space or user licenses. It encompasses the ability to scale computing resources, such as processing power and bandwidth, to maintain consistent performance during periods of peak demand. A large-scale marketing campaign, for example, may generate a surge in inbound electronic mail traffic, potentially overwhelming inadequately provisioned servers. Hosting providers with elastic scalability, capable of dynamically allocating resources as needed, can prevent service disruptions and ensure a seamless user experience. Furthermore, scalability should also encompass the ability to integrate new features and functionalities, such as advanced security protocols or collaboration tools, as they become available.
